Arts Unleashed is an theatre company that believes children have unlimited creativity and imagination. Their unique style combines art and drama and focuses on small groups and BIG experiences. Their aim is to give children a sense of self-expression and independence, and to help them explore their creativity and individuality.

You can also call your local shelter dealing with domestic violence. Safety planning classes are offered by many shelters to help women protect themselves.

  • In a January 2018 survey of 1,000 women nationwide, 81 percent reported experiencing some form of sexual harassment, assault, or both in their lifetime. (healthline.com)
  • The Rape, Abuse & Incest National Network reports that 70 percent of sexual violence cases aren't committed by random strangers in a dark alley but by people we know: friends, family, partners, co-workers, etc. (healthline.com)
